A UNIVERSE OF SONGS AND STORIES
Cotuit Library 871 Main Street - Cotuit, MA (508) 428-8141
The Cotuit Library will celebrate
April School Vacation and the coming 2019 Summer Reading Program
by presenting a performance for families by Parents’ Choice
Award winning performing Davis Bates. Entitled A Universe of
Songs and Stories, the program will involve the audience in a
variety of cultural traditions. Hear how stars came to be in the
sky, how foam came to be in the ocean, and be prepared to sing,
move and clap your hands. The program will include plenty of
sing-alongs, as well as a short lesson in how to play the
spoons, and an appearance by an Irish dancing wooden dog named
Bingo.
Pete Seeger called Davis "thoughtful, creative, human, and a
fantastic storyteller." Davis' traditional and participatory
performance style empowers and encourages audiences of all ages
to join in the fun, and to take the songs and stories home with
them to share with others. He also encourages listeners to
remember and tell stories from their own family and cultural
traditions.
Davis Bates has been telling stories for over forty years, in
schools, libraries, colleges and community settings around New
England and across the country. His recording of Family Stories
won a Parent’s Choice Gold Award, and was named one of the
year’s best Audio Recordings by Booklist Magazine. Davis has
also served as director and consultant for several local and
regional oral history and folk arts projects. Davis lives in the
village of Shelburne Falls, MA, and when he isn't collecting or
learning stories he spends his time gardening, cutting cordwood
and working various pollinator and wildlife preservation
projects.

SCI-FI BOOK CLUB
Cotuit Library 871 Main Street - Cotuit, MA (508) 428-8141
The Cotuit Library Sci-Fi Book Club
is meeting once again for some stellar book discussing. This
month we will be reading All Systems Red by Martha Wells, the
first novella in The Murderbot Diaries. Copies will be available
for checkout at the library and in ebook form on Libby leading
up to the event.
Check out this sinopsis of All Systems Red and then come to the
library and grab your copy:
“In a corporate-dominated spacefaring future, planetary missions
must be approved and supplied by the Company. Exploratory teams
are accompanied by Company-supplied security androids, for their
own safety.
“But in a society where contracts are awarded to the lowest
bidder, safety isn’t a primary concern.
“On a distant planet, a team of scientists are conducting
surface tests, shadowed by their Company-supplied ‘droid ― a
self-aware SecUnit that has hacked its own governor module, and
refers to itself (though never out loud) as “Murderbot.”
Scornful of humans, all it really wants is to be left alone long
enough to figure out who it is.
“But when a neighboring mission goes dark, it's up to the
scientists and their Murderbot to get to the truth.”
